Effects Of Different Tillage Methods On Temporal And Spatial Distribution Of Soil Moisture And Growth Of Maize In Cinnamon Soil Of Western Liaoning

The cinnamon soil area in western Liaoning is arid and semi-arid.The area has sufficient sunlight,but the rainfall is unevenly distributed.Rainfall is mostly concentrated in summer and spring drought is severe.In view of these status quo,predecessors have conducted a lot of research,such as drip irrigation with film mulching,straw mulching,and no-tillage sowing,all of which have certain effects,but a single model has certain limitations on water resources and water use efficiency.Therefore,it should be systematically considered from the aspects of water storage and moisture preservation,which has a lot of room for expansion in improving water use efficiency.This paper investigates the problems existing in the soil plow layer under the traditional farming mode of farmers,and then establishes the research content.Through fixed-point field experiments,the establishment of rotary tillage,plowing,autumn sub-soiling,and no-till straw mulching plus inter-tillage sub-soiling(integrated mode for short))Four treatments,with rotary tillage as a control,to explore the effects of different tillage methods on soil moisture,corn growth,corn yield,WUE,NUE,and economy in the severe spring drought years(2018)and normal years(2019)during the corn growth period The impact of benefits.The selection of farming methods suitable for the climate and soil in the west of Liaoning will provide scientific basis and technical support for the increase of corn production in the west of Liaoning under the background of drought.The research results are as follows:1.The traditional farming mode of the farmers in the cinnamon soil area of western Liaoning is clear stubble and shallow rotation.Due to long-term rotation,the soil plow layer becomes shallower,the smallest is only 8cm;the plow bottom becomes thicker,the thickest is 18cm;it seriously hinders the growth of corn root system.In the severe spring drought year(2018),the soil water content in the spring planting period was low,and the soil volumetric water content was only12.12%;the rainfall in the spring planting period in the year of sufficient rain(2019)was also scarce,and the soil volumetric water content was only 12.19%.,Affect the emergence of corn,and then affect the yield of corn.2.The effects of different tillage methods in 2018 and 2019 on soil moisture in cinnamon soil region of western Liaoning were studied.The results showed that:(1)compared with traditional spring rotary tillage,in the year of severe spring drought(2018),the tillage methods of autumn tillage and deep tillage in autumn had little effect on soil water content(12.12-24.15%,12.54-24.13%,12.95-24.02%)in tilling layer(0-20cm),but the integrated model had significant effect on the soil water content of the tilth layer in the whole growth period(the soil water content of the integrated model was between 14.13%and 25.42%)The soil water content in deep layer(60-80CM)during the whole growth period of maize was less affected by tillage in autumn and subsoiling in autumn(18.45-24.32%by rotary tillage and 18.91-24.44%by tillage),but the effect of subsoiling and integration on soil water content in deep layer during the whole growth period of maize was significant.(deep pine 21.99-26.31%;integration 22.12-27.15%).In the year of sufficient rainfall(2019),the integrated treatment had a significant effect on the soil water content in the tilth and deep soil layers during the whole growing period of maize,while the other treatments had little effect on the soil water content in the tilth and deep soil layers during the whole growing period of maize.(2)the precipitation in fallow period in 2018 and 2019 was 59.6 mm and 171 mm respectively,but the water storage efficiency of integrated and subsoiling treatment was higher than that of rotary tillage and tillage,and was close to each other,being 28.18%,26.33%,43.48%and 41.43%,respectively.(3)the water storage and rainfall in 2018 and 2019 showed that the soil water storage in 0-80cm section of integrated treatment was significantly higher than other treatments when the rainfall was less during the growing period of maize.When the rainfall was sufficient in the growing period of maize,the soil water storage of subsoiling treatment increased,which was similar to that of integrated treatment and significantly higher than that of tillage and rotary tillage treatment.3.The key limiting factor of maize emergence rate is the soil moisture after maize sowing;in a drought year(2018),the integrated treatment maize starts to grow slowly,and then the growth rate becomes faster;the subsoiling maize grows better than other treatments.Compared with rotary tillage(CK),sub-soiling and integrated treatments significantly increased the root mass of the 30-40cm level by 102.28 and 123.4%.In the year of sufficient rain(2019),there was no significant difference in the growth of corn under different treatments.The subsoiling and integrated treatments slightly increased the root mass by 20-40cm,by 21.6%and 30.1%respectively.4.In the dry year(2018)and the rainy year(2019),the corn yield in the cinnamon soil area of western Liaoning was the highest in integrated treatment and the lowest in rotary tillage.Compared with rotary tillage(CK),integrated processing increased the output by 16.39%in 2018 and 8.54%in 2019.5.In 2018 and 2019,the water use efficiency(Wue)of different tillage systems was the highest,36.61 kg HM 2 mm-1 and 32.2 kg HM 2 mm-1,respectively,which increased by 17.11%and 21.97%compared with rotary tillage(CK)In 2018 and 2019,the nitrogen use efficiency(nue)of different tillage systems was also the highest,41.41 kg-1 and 52.00 kg-1,respectively,which were 16.39%and 8.56%higher than that of rotary tillage(CK).6.The net income of integrated processing in 2018 and 2019 was significantly higher than that of other processing,with the best economic benefits.Compared with rotary farming,the net income of integrated processing corn increased by 2185.07 yuan·hm~2 in 2018,and the net income of integrated processing corn increased by 1413.65 yuan·hm~2 in 2019.The integrated mode is a farming method that can increase the income of locals.From the above conclusions,it can be seen that no-tillage straw mulch plus intertillage subsoiling can better improve soil water storage and moisture retention capacity,corn yield,water and nitrogen use efficiency,and corn economic benefits in spring than rotary tillage,subsoiling and plowing.A farming method that is suitable for the cinnamon soil area in western Liaoning and worthy of promotion.
